Career Options After 12th Science
If you studied Physics, Chemistry, and Biology or Mathematics, you are a science student. Science gives you many paths to choose from. Here are the career options after 12th science:
1. Doctor (MBBS)
You study medicine
Help sick people
Work in hospitals
2. Dentist (BDS)
Take care of teeth and mouth
Study dental science
3. Nurse or Paramedic
Help doctors in hospitals
Give first aid and medicines
4. Engineer (BTech)
Build roads, bridges, machines, or apps
Choose from computer, civil, mechanical, or electrical fields
5. Scientist
Work in labs
Do research and discover new things
6. Pharmacist (BPharma)
Learn about medicines
Work in medical shops or hospitals
7. Architect (BArch)
Design buildings and homes
Use maths and creativity
8. Pilot
Fly airplanes
Need to pass special exams and medical tests
9. IT and Computer Courses
Learn coding, web design, or data science
These are modern career options after 12th science
10. Agriculture and Food Science
Study plants and farming
Help grow better food
Science gives both medical and non-medical paths. You can choose based on your interest.
Best Career Options After 12th Commerce
If you studied business, accounts, and economics, you are a commerce student. You can choose from many jobs. Here are some of the best career options after 12th for commerce:
1. Chartered Accountant (CA)
Work with numbers
Help companies manage money
2. Company Secretary (CS)
Work with company laws
Help run businesses
3. Banker
Work in banks
Help people with savings and loans
4. Accountant
Keep records of money
Work in small or big firms
5. Stock Market Expert
Buy and sell shares
Study the economy
6. E-Commerce Specialist
Sell things online
Use websites and mobile apps
7. Business Management (BBA or MBA)
Learn how to run a company
Become a business leader
8. Hotel Management
Work in hotels and restaurants
Meet people from many places
Best Career Options After 12th Arts
Arts or humanities students study history, geography, languages, and social science. These students can follow creative or social jobs. Some of the best career options after 12th in arts are:
1. Teacher
Teach children in school
Share knowledge and help students grow
2. Lawyer
Study law
Help people get justice
3. Journalist
Write news articles
Work on TV or in newspapers
4. Social Worker
Help poor or sick people
Work in NGOs or social groups
5. Government Jobs
Appear for exams like UPSC or SSC
Become officers or clerks
6. Writer or Author
Write books, stories, or blogs
Work from home or in publishing
7. Actor or Artist
Work in films or TV
Show your talent in drawing or acting
8. Event Manager
Plan big functions
Handle weddings, shows, or business events

Career Options in India and Abroad
You can work in India or go to other countries. If you want to go abroad, learn English well and get a valid certificate. Countries like Canada, UK, USA, and Australia offer jobs in:
Nursing
IT
Hotel management
Construction
Engineering
You may need to take IELTS or other language exams.
